For live events, sports, and cultural venue owners and partners to discuss the current dynamics, share best practices, innovative initiatives and trends, and the future vision of the industry. The conference offers three days of programming featuring topics ranging from content and bookings, hospitality, premium experiences, venue optimization, new trends in security, data, technology, and the diverse realities facing venues today.
VenuesNow features a half-day of curated content highlighting best practices in sustainability across all venue types, including how to manage energy, water, and waste effectively and the critical levers to ensure financial sustainability, corporate partnerships and guest experience.
VenuesNow brings together the thought leaders, influencers, and visionaries who help us create a positive disruption in the sports and live entertainment venue industry. Over 80% of our audience holds the title of Director or above and is representative of various sectors of the business, with nearly 1,000 in-person attendees.
